1 Killed, 8 Injured In Suspected Cylinder Explosion In Bengaluru

A 10-year-old boy was killed and eight others sustained injuries in a suspected LPG cylinder explosion in Bengaluru’s Chinnayanpalya on Friday morning, said police. Read more

No Document To Be Signed After Putin-Trump Alaska Summit, Says Kremlin

Kremlin spokesperson Dmitry Peskov said on Friday that no document is expected to be signed after the Alaska summit between Russian President Vladimir Putin and US President Donald Trump. Read more

Jeff Bezos’s Mother, Jacklyn Gise Bezos, Dies At 78. Amazon Founder Pays Heartfelt Tribute

Amazon founder Jeff Bezos mother, Jacklyn Gise Bezos, passed away on Thursday. Jacklyn was 78. She breathed her last at her home in Miami. Read more

Virender Sehwag’s Big Reveal: ‘MS Dhoni Dropped Me, I Went To Sachin Tendulkar…’

One of India’s greatest openers, Virender Sehwag, has revealed that he had considered retiring from ODI cricket before the 2011 World Cup after then-captain MS Dhoni dropped him from the 11 for a long time. He said he was convinced by his batting partner and legend Sachin Tendulkar against that decision. Read more
